The SEHP Membership Unit manages the integrity of enrollment data for over 80,000 employees and their families covered under the State Employee Health Plan (SEHP). The Membership Services Team delivers comprehensive support for daily eligibility and membership transactions, spanning the entire member lifecycle. The Membership Services Team is the primary engine for member support, navigating complex membership changes including new hire onboarding, life-event changes, and the peak during the annual Open Enrollment period.
Reporting to the Senior Manager of Membership Services, the BenefitsConsultant serves as a subject matter expert across state agencies, Non State Public Employer (NSPE) groups, and COBRA enrollees. This role is designed for cross-functional versatility, ensuring operational continuity and fostering a collaborative team environment. The position requires great attention to detail and excellent customer service skills when communicating with the customer via telephone or email on a daily basis.
Job Responsibilities:
* Compliance & Regulatory Oversight: Apply SEHP eligibility rules and regulations, validate eligibility for diverse membership changes, including complex retirement and termination cases. Rigorous oversight of the Membership Administration Portal (MAP) to ensure before approving enrollment changes that all supporting documentation is received, that requests meet eligibility criteria guidelines and are in line with the cafeteria plan rules. Set up COBRA accounts and work with COBRA administrator to address any questions or issues on the account.
* Data Integrity & Reporting: Recognize that precision is critical to ensuring accurate premium contributions, payroll deductions, and adherence to eligibility policy and procedures. Maintained 100% accuracy in a high-volume database environment, ensuring over 80,000 members received uninterrupted health coverage. Execute complex data entry within the Membership Administration Portal (MAP) to process new enrollments, terminations, and life event changes. Proactively resolve data discrepancies with carriers to ensure seamless eligibility. Manage the lifecycle of membership data by auditing and reconciling SEHP, Carrier, and COBRA reports.
* Advanced Data Reporting: Utilize the Membership Administration Portal (MAP) to generate complex eligibility reports and send automated member correspondence. Analyze report data to identify and execute necessary record adjustments.
* Stakeholder Consultation: Serve as a primary liaison for members and HR representatives, providing expert guidance via phone and email. Act as a point of contact for insurers and vendors to troubleshoot and sync membership files and eligibility issues. Coordinate directly with insurance carriers and vendors to resolve discrepancies.
* Appeals & Exceptions Support: Evaluate requests for plan appeals or exceptions; prepare and present findings to leadership for formal resolution.
* Operational Agility: Execute special projects and cross-functional duties as assigned to support the evolving needs of the State Employee Health Plan.

How much does a benefits consultant earn in Topeka, KS?
The average benefits consultant in Topeka, KS earns between $48,000 and $125,000 annually. This compares to the national average benefits consultant range of $51,000 to $121,000.
